A king size bed may take up a significant amount of room, but it doesn’t mean you have to compromise on comfort or aesthetics. Here are some tips to help you effectively arrange your king size bed without feeling cramped.1. Consider the LayoutStart by evaluating the layout of your bedroom. Measure the dimensions of the room and the bed, then visualize where the bed will fit best. Ideally, you want to place the bed in a way that allows for easy movement around the room. Consider the following layouts:Center Placement: Position the bed in the center of the longest wall. This creates symmetry and balances the room.Corner Setup: If space is really tight, placing the bed in a corner can free up walking space and make the room feel more open.2. Use Multi-Functional FurnitureIn small bedrooms, every piece of furniture should serve multiple purposes. Consider using a bed with built-in storage drawers underneath or a headboard with shelving. This way, you can store essentials without cluttering the space.3. Optimize Vertical SpaceUtilize wall space by installing shelves or cabinets above the bed. This draws the eye upward, making the room feel larger and provides additional storage for books, decor, or other items.4. Keep It Light and BrightA small room can feel cramped with dark colors. Opt for light-colored bedding, curtains, and walls to create an airy and inviting atmosphere. Mirrors can also enhance the feeling of space by reflecting light.5. Create a Cozy NookIf there’s enough room, consider adding a small chair or bench at the foot of the bed. This can serve as a cozy reading nook or a place to lay out clothes, adding functionality without sacrificing style.6. Maintain an Organized SpaceDecluttering is key in a small bedroom. Keep surfaces clear and store items out of sight to maintain a serene environment.
